workItem
@Deprecated private java.lang.String workItem
Deprecated.Some SCMs have the concept of a work item (or task) which may need to be specified to allow changes to be pushed or delivered to a target. This allows you to answer the question: For this workItem, what changed? Auditors have been known to love this... :) SCMs known to implement this are:- IBM Rational Team Concert (workItem)
- Microsoft Team Foundation Server (workItem)
- IBM Rational ClearQuest Enabled UCM ClearCase (task)
These SCMs can be configured to reject a push/deliver unless additional information (by way of a workItem/task) is supplied.
This field is only relevant when pushChanges = true.
It should be noted however, when pushChanges = true, a workItem does not need to be set, as the need for a workItem may be optional.

isPersistCheckout
@Deprecated public boolean isPersistCheckout()
Deprecated.Will checkouts using this repository be persisted so they can be refreshed in the future? This property is of concern to SCMs like Perforce and Clearcase where the server must track where a user checks out to. If false, the server entry (clientspec in Perforce terminology) will be deleted after the checkout is complete so the files will not be able to be updated.This setting can be overriden by using the system property "maven.scm.persistcheckout" to true.
The default is false. See SCM-113 for more detail.
